Default Induction whistle

Hi Guys

I have a K&N typhoon induction kit fitted and when I accelerate normally I get an annoying whistle sounds bit like fan belt slipping (but not before people say).

Has anyone else suffered this noise? If so did you cure it? May put standard box back in

CHeers
